BOISE PROFILE


Boise is the capital city and largest city of Idaho and is located in the Boise river valley.

Boise is the home of Boise State University and the Hawks, a professional baseball minor league team.

Hiking and biking are popular pastimes in the foothills to the city's north or downtown along the Boise river. Winter sports are available at Bogus Basin resort just 16 miles from downtown. Fly fishing and white water sports are world class.

Among GreatPlacesToRetire cities, Boise ranks high in man-made hazards risk and medical care. Boise ranks low in natural hazards risk and water quality.
